Not staying logged into my Xfinity Email account

I've been trying to figure out the past few days, now, why I've been redirected to xfinity.com/overview from Comcast.net. and why my login is not holding even when I selected the option to stay logged into my account? I've tried manually typing in "my.xfinity.com" to get to my own homepage instead of Xfinity overview homepage, but I have to log into my account every time, regardless.

From the link -To stay signed in:

Don't log out.
Don't use Private Browsing when you log in.
Check the "Stay signed in" box when you log in.
Make sure your browser accepts all the cookies the Comcast login process sets and retains them between sessions.
If you use any sort of registry cleaner or other "system tuneup" software, make sure it is not set to delete cookies. Web browsers may have similar settings.
